Key Phrases and Expressions in the Dutch Language

Knowing a few common phrases and expressions will help make conversations smoother, and more natural, and increase your chances of success! 

Let’s start with basic greetings. “Hallo/hoi/hey” are some of the most common ways to say hello in Dutch. You can also use “Goedemorgen” (Good Morning), “Goedenavond” (Good Evening), or “Dag!” (Bye!). It’s important to note that when talking on the phone or online you should say “Hoi!” instead of “Hallo!”.

4 Creative Date Ideas in the Netherlands

  1. Enjoy Dutch Cuisine at Eetwinkel: 

For foodies who want to sample some delicious Dutch cuisine on their date night out, head over to Eetwinkel located in Utrecht’s city center! 

This cozy restaurant serves authentic dishes like kroketten, and bitterballen as well as homemade desserts like stroopwafel, perfect if you have a sweet tooth! 

  1. Go Windsurfing in Scheveningen: 

If adventurous activities are more your thing then why not try windsurfing on the North Sea coast at Scheveningen Beach? 

It’s one of Europe’s best spots for windsurfing so if either of you knows how or would like to give it a go then this could be great fun and also get those endorphins flowing during your romantic outing together! 

  1. Visit Cheese Market Alkmaar:

Visiting local cheese markets located inside towns across the Netherlands provides a lovely experience of how the original cheese wheel is still produced today same manner it used to centuries ago. 

Particularly in the Alkmaar market every Friday morning even tourists come along locals just watch the entire process involved in making wheels while sampling a few types afterward! 

  1. Take a romantic canal cruise through Amsterdam: 

Amsterdam is known for its beautiful canals, so why not experience them together while taking in the sights of the city from the water? 

Many companies offer romantic boat rides at sunset, complete with cheese and wine tastings on board. It’s an ideal way to relax and enjoy each other’s company while admiring the beauty of Amsterdam from afar.
